Sa. Oliver et al., ANISOTROPIC ANTIFERROMAGNETIC INTERLAYER COUPLING IN FE CR/FE FILMS/, Journal of magnetism and magnetic materials, 128(1-2), 1993, pp. 151-156
In-plane and oblique-angle ferromagnetic resonance measurements were p
erformed on Fe/Cr/Fe samples in order to measure the exchange coupling
values between the magnetic layers for the in-plane and normal geomet
ries. Samples consisted of well characterized Fe/Cr sandwiches grown b
y molecular beam epitaxy onto (001) GaAs with different Cr layer thick
nesses (t(Cr)). All samples had previously been shown by other experim
ental techniques to have antiferromagnetic coupling of the Fe layers.
For one sample (t(Cr) = 20 angstrom) the deduced in-plane and perpendi
cular values of the exchange coupling coincide. In the second sample (
t(Cr) = 13 angstrom) the deduced exchange coupling values for in-plane
and perpendicular magnetization orientations were found to differ by
10%.
